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ians will ass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further water damage. We’ll use plastic barriers and tarps to keep the area dry and prevent water from spreading.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ract standing water from your home. Our technicians will work quickly to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ry your home thoroughly. We’ll use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once your home is dry, our technicians will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is dry and safe.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ups to ensure your home is back to normal.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ost In Quincy, MA

The cost of emergency water remov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Quincy, MA.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of moisture present.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ning required.
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 The extent of the damage and the amount of repair required.
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Package $1,000 – $5,000 The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Quincy, MA.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for emergency water removal services in Quincy, MA.
